Efektivní kontrola dlouhých dokumentů je nyní snazší než kdy jindy s novou funkcí Shrnutí dokumentů v AI v Aspose.Words. Ať už připravujete abstrakty, generujete rychlé postřehy nebo zjednodušujete kontrolu obsahu, Tato funkce vám umožní vytvářet stručné souhrny během několika sekund pomocí pokročilých generativních modelů AI od OpenAI a Google.
Jak shrnout dokument v Aspose.Words
Aspose.Words zjednodušuje sumarizaci dokumentu pomocí jmenného prostoru Aspose.Words.AI . Pomocí metody Create se vývojáři mohou připojit k modelům AI a nastavit klíče API. Poté pomocí metody Summarize a vlastnosti SummaryLength mohou shrnout text a nakonfigurovat možnosti, jako je požadovaná délka souhrnu.
S několika řádky kódu můžete integrovat výkonné funkce AI přímo do vaší aplikace. Následující příklad kódu ukazuje, jak shrnout dokument pomocí Aspose.Words s modelem GPT-4o:
Document firstDoc = new Document(MyDir + "Big document.docx");
Document secondDoc = new Document(MyDir + "Document.docx");
string apiKey = Environment.GetEnvironmentVariable("API_KEY");
// Use OpenAI or Google generative language models.
IAiModelText model = (IAiModelText)AiModel.Create(AiModelType.Gpt4OMini).WithApiKey(apiKey);
Document oneDocumentSummary = model.Summarize(firstDoc, new SummarizeOptions() { SummaryLength = SummaryLength.Short });
oneDocumentSummary.Save(ArtifactsDir + "AI.AiSummarize.One.docx");
Document multiDocumentSummary = model.Summarize(new Document[] { firstDoc, secondDoc }, new SummarizeOptions() { SummaryLength = SummaryLength.Long });
multiDocumentSummary.Save(ArtifactsDir + "AI.AiSummarize.Multi.docx");
Proč použít Aspose.Words pro shrnutí?
- Zjednodušený proces: shrňte dokumenty s minimálním kódem
- Přizpůsobitelné souhrny: upravte délku souhrnu tak, aby vyhovovala konkrétním potřebám
- AI integrace: použijte špičkové modely od OpenAI a Google
Začněte ještě dnes a nechte Aspose.Words snadno a přesně zpracovat vaše potřeby sumarizace dokumentů. Pro více informací navštivte Aspose.Words API documentation.